Quartz Wave generator Insights: Determining the Right Frequency

Opting for some suitable crystal signal frequency is necessary for reliable instrument operation. Examine individual exact demands; some slightly maladjusted signal can generate serious challenges. Generally, regular crystal pulse rates are offered in divisions of 32.768 kHz (215 Hz), for example 1.0 MHz, 4.0 MHz, 8.0 MHz, and 16.0 MHz. Yet specific jobs may require alternative oscillations. Ensure to validate accordance with design's module or fixed system.

Sensor Unit Assimilation: Recommended Approaches and Usual Challenges

Embedding detection packages into a expanded apparatus involves accurate strategy and realization. Preferred approaches necessitate exhaustive assessment preceding full assembly unification. Verify appropriate power sources, signal conditioning, and gateway procedures.

  • Deal with ground net difficulties in advance of assembly, as this can introduce background interference and misleading data.
  • Focus meticulous attention to working factors such as temperature, condensation and resonance.
  • Log the joining procedure painstakingly to help future diagnosis.
Typical issues consist of missing suitability barriers, lacking handling purification, and deficiency of correct adjustment. Skipping that type of aspects can create errors and compromised stability.
